Victor Marmol
3ae717be97
Merge pull request #5094 from gmarek/client4
...
Refactor Kubelets syncPod function by wrapping some functionalities into separate functions
2015-03-06 10:58:05 -08:00
Victor Marmol
4f3f073f3c
Implementing ImageManager to take over image lifecycle.
...
All images are tracked, when they were created and when they were last
used. FreeSpace() evicts these images in least recently used order,
breaking ties with oldest first.
2015-03-06 10:48:28 -08:00
Yu-Ju Hong
3ccdb8db98
kubelet: reject pods on host port conflict
...
When a host port conflict is detected, kubelet should set the pod status to
fail. The failed status will then be polled by other components at a later time,
which allows replication controller to create a new pod if necessary.
To achieve this, this change stores the pod status information in a status map
upon the detecton of port conflict. GetPodStatus() consults this status map
before attempting to query docker. The entries in the status map will be removed
when the pod is no longer associated with the node.
2015-03-06 10:46:49 -08:00
Deyuan Deng
3c460831ca
Use FormatInt instead of string for external id.
2015-03-06 13:45:52 -05:00
Derek Carr
d99e9f728c
Merge pull request #5050 from dchen1107/cleanup
...
Convert both namespace and limitrange examples to v1beta3
2015-03-06 13:26:23 -05:00
roberthbailey
0d6b57ccdb
Merge pull request #5134 from jlowdermilk/e2e
...
fix Errorf argument mismatch in test/e2e/util.go
2015-03-06 10:21:44 -08:00
Daniel Smith
244766ac89
Merge pull request #5002 from satnam6502/proxy-200
...
Do not fail status 200 responses to proxy calls
2015-03-06 10:20:07 -08:00
Daniel Smith
b0f49449e1
Merge pull request #4985 from thockin/gofuzz
...
Update gofuzz dep
2015-03-06 10:19:01 -08:00
Victor Marmol
f3315b8350
Adding github.com/stretchr/testify/require godep.
2015-03-06 09:50:07 -08:00
Jeff Lowdermilk
f7a491958b
fix Errorf argument mismatch in test/e2e/util.go
2015-03-06 09:36:37 -08:00
gmarek
4a01a4dbf5
Refactor Kubelets syncPod function by wrapping some functionalities into functions
2015-03-06 18:32:11 +01:00
Tim Hockin
ca265c5705
Merge pull request #4898 from gmarek/client2
...
Loosen label and annotation validation and related tests
2015-03-06 09:14:24 -08:00
Tim Hockin
788d9994a1
Merge pull request #5132 from pmorie/mount-refactor
...
Fix mount refactor nits
2015-03-06 09:00:01 -08:00
Tim Hockin
c2ebad2ac0
Merge pull request #5131 from brendandburns/service
...
Place external load balancers in a namespace.
2015-03-06 08:49:37 -08:00
Paul Morie
17b51a93a3
Fix mount refactor nits
2015-03-06 11:46:07 -05:00
Tim Hockin
f9e2df3a10
Define semantic equal for time
2015-03-06 08:21:39 -08:00
Tim Hockin
0b38282b9b
Fuzz util.Time with no nsec because JSON
2015-03-06 08:21:10 -08:00
Tim Hockin
b3304c49ad
Use deep spew in serialization test & go obj diff
2015-03-06 08:21:10 -08:00
Tim Hockin
cee14ab51b
Update gofuzz dep
2015-03-06 08:21:10 -08:00
Brendan Burns
5b6a78fc77
Place external load balancers in a namespace, and add a test to validate the behavior.
2015-03-06 17:16:27 +01:00
Brendan Burns
2700871b04
Merge pull request #5013 from smarterclayton/misc_fixup
...
Small cleanups to a number of client behaviors
2015-03-06 15:41:34 +01:00
Brendan Burns
de669b5435
Merge pull request #5058 from bprashanth/resourceVersion_doc
...
Clarify resourceVersion documentation
2015-03-06 15:41:12 +01:00
Brendan Burns
ea7c54e4c3
Merge pull request #5071 from jlowdermilk/docs
...
Add documentation on legacy kubernetes_auth file to kubeconfig-file.md
2015-03-06 15:40:56 +01:00
Brendan Burns
2263d86a7b
Merge pull request #5073 from yujuhong/immutable
...
v1beta1/v1beta2: fields that cannot be updated are marked immutable
2015-03-06 15:40:43 +01:00
derekwaynecarr
2ed8eed004
Make admission control plug-ins work from indexes
2015-03-06 09:36:57 -05:00
Brendan Burns
d4755704b1
Merge pull request #5104 from liggitt/secure_kubelet
...
Plumb tls and cert options into kubelet start
2015-03-06 15:32:23 +01:00
Brendan Burns
ee351b3f9c
Merge pull request #5110 from justinsb/aws_ginkgo_auth_config_path
...
auth_config path for aws for ginkgo
2015-03-06 15:29:53 +01:00
Brendan Burns
7cb70b0a98
Merge pull request #5114 from justinsb/aws_set_instance_names
...
Set AWS instance Names so they match the regex
2015-03-06 15:26:36 +01:00
Brendan Burns
784dd82880
Merge pull request #5117 from lavalamp/fix4
...
Make unexported fields panic (informatively) instead of silently passing
2015-03-06 15:21:54 +01:00
Brendan Burns
4baa061130
Merge pull request #5123 from ZJU-SEL/hsm
...
Update the ubuntu-cluster docs and scripts to 0.12.0
2015-03-06 15:18:56 +01:00
Brendan Burns
20d9dd9e9c
Merge pull request #5125 from mikedanese/shadowing-bug
...
fix variable shadowing bug in etcd_tools.go
2015-03-06 15:16:52 +01:00
Brendan Burns
6ed5bc2bcc
Merge pull request #5126 from endocode/karl/celery-example
...
New example: Distributed task queue
2015-03-06 15:15:46 +01:00
Brendan Burns
8c70fe5475
Merge pull request #5127 from rsokolowski/skydns-resilient-to-restart
...
Update version of kube2sky to 1.1.
2015-03-06 15:13:50 +01:00
gmarek
26b7fbeedf
apply comments
2015-03-06 13:21:40 +01:00
rsokolowski
5aa46e6342
Update version of kube2sky to 1.1.
2015-03-06 10:00:57 +01:00
Satnam Singh
cb4c931b0b
Do not fail status 200 responses to proxy calls
2015-03-06 00:29:19 -08:00
Karl Beecher
43ab8188c8
New example: Distributed task queue
...
Adds an example of using Kubernetes to build a distributed task queue
using Celery along with a RabbitMQ broker and Flower frontend.
Resolves : #1788
2015-03-06 09:15:14 +01:00
gmarek
bb8a4f5ed3
apply comments
2015-03-06 08:23:22 +01:00
gmarek
726a5af075
Loosen label and annotation validation and related tests
2015-03-06 08:23:22 +01:00
Mike Danese
438052c453
fix variable shadowing bug in etcd_tools.go
2015-03-05 22:34:28 -08:00
Dawn Chen
54b2b47caa
Merge pull request #4756 from vishh/kubelet
...
Relax constraints on container status while fetching container logs
2015-03-05 21:49:48 -08:00
Daniel Smith
3ef3777192
Make unexported fields panic (informatively)
...
...Also fix some incorrect calls to semantic.DeepEqual, and a bug where
it returned true incorrectly.
2015-03-05 21:40:37 -08:00
Prashanth Balasubramanian
1ed3f7ffcd
Clarify documentation around resourceVersion
2015-03-05 20:57:22 -08:00
wizard
ca16a57b54
Add cleanup function to make the build.sh more robust
2015-03-06 12:10:37 +08:00
Derek Carr
ab58268d7e
Merge pull request #5077 from fabioy/doc-fixit
...
Update Vagrant starter guide.
2015-03-05 22:51:56 -05:00
wizard
c80ef5de60
Make the k8s version configurable
2015-03-06 11:04:30 +08:00
wizard
282b1be188
update getting-started-guided README
2015-03-06 10:52:28 +08:00
Yu-Ju Hong
823ea36cb1
v1beta1/v1beta2: fields that cannot be updated are marked "cannot be udpated"
2015-03-05 18:05:13 -08:00
Victor Marmol
79f2773745
Merge pull request #5120 from dchen1107/docker
...
monit health check kubelet and restart unhealthy one
2015-03-05 17:39:03 -08:00
Dawn Chen
a934efe3e5
Convert limitrange example to v1beta3
2015-03-05 17:38:32 -08:00